The Significance of Historic Windows


In the context of architectural history, windows are more than simply practical openings for light and air. They show the technological capabilities and artistic trends of their era. From the thick, hand-blown glass of the Georgian period to the intricate leaded lights of the Victorian era, every detail informs a story.

Generic contemporary replacements often stop working to catch the subtle nuances of historic windows. Mass-produced timber or uPVC frames lack the slim profiles and authentic joinery of original windows, often resulting in a “flat” look that lessens the property's heritage value. This is where experts step in, focusing on preservation rather than simple replacement.

Navigating Regulatory Frameworks


For owners of listed structures or properties located within conservation locations, the legal structure surrounding window modifications is rigid. Historical home window professionals need to be fluent in regional and nationwide preparation policies.

In lots of jurisdictions, replacing initial windows with modern double glazing is forbidden due to the fact that it changes the profile and reflection of the building. Specialists work carefully with preservation officers to propose options— such as “Slimlite” glazing or discreet draught-proofing— that satisfy both the desire for comfort and the legal requirement for conservation.

Technical Innovations in Restoration


The primary objective of a window professional is to enhance a window's performance without altering its appearance. This is accomplished through several specialized methods.

Lumber Repair and Resin Stabilization

Rather than changing a decaying windowsill, experts utilize “splicing” (getting rid of only the harmed section and fitting new, experienced wood) or sophisticated epoxy resins. These resins can stabilize soft, decaying wood, bonding with the initial fibers to produce a structural repair that is virtually unnoticeable once painted.

Draught-Proofing Systems

Among the biggest complaints relating to historical windows is heat loss and rattling. Specialists set up perimeter sealing systems. These include machining a small groove into the window beads or the sashes themselves and placing a brush or silicone seal. This substantially minimizes air seepage while remaining undetectable when the window is closed.

Professional Glazing

Conventional double glazing is normally too thick (20mm+) for historical rebates. Professionals use “slim-profile” vacuum glazing or gas-filled systems that are as thin as 6mm or 10mm. These systems supply thermal insulation similar to contemporary windows while fitting into the initial thin glazing bars.

The Benefits of Hiring a Specialist


Picking a general carpenter over a historical window professional can cause numerous concerns, from structural failure to legal fines. The benefits of using a specialist include:

  1. Preservation of Value: Authentic functions are a considerable chauffeur of property worth in the heritage market.
  2. Professional Tools: They have unique tools, such as moulding planes to match 150-year-old profiles.
  3. Understanding of Glass: They comprehend the difference between cylinder, crown, and drawn glass, ensuring that the “wobble” and character of the glass are maintained.
  4. Long-lasting Sustainability: Restoring a window is inherently more sustainable than producing, transporting, and setting up a brand-new plastic or aluminum unit.

Often Asked Questions (FAQ)


Can historical windows be double-glazed?

In most cases, yes. While basic double glazing is typically too thick, experts can use slim-profile systems or vacuum glass that fits within the existing wood rebates of many sash and casement windows. However, this generally needs preparing permission for noted structures.

How often do brought back historical windows need upkeep?

If a professional utilizes high-quality oils, resins, and paints, the wood must be checked every 5 to 7 years. Since historic windows are developed to be taken apart and fixed, they can last forever if the paint film is maintained.

Is it less expensive to repair or replace?

Initial repair expenses can in some cases be similar to the expense of a high-end bespoke replacement. However, repair work is almost always less expensive than a like-for-like top quality replacement and brings the added benefit of preserving the building's historical integrity and avoiding planning problems.

Why not just utilize uPVC “heritage” windows?

Even top quality uPVC heritage windows have different reflective qualities and thicker frame profiles than original lumber. Furthermore, uPVC is a “disposable” product; when the seal fails or the frame breaks down, the entire system must be replaced. Lumber windows are “repairable” units.

What is the primary reason for window failure?

Paint failure is the most common cause. When paint cracks, moisture gets in the lumber and becomes trapped, leading to fungal rot. Correct preparation and the use of microporous paints by professionals prevent this cycle.
